oncedisturbed
2nd August 2013, 09:24 PM
The M1 is their new flagship model and is pretty sweet. IOS has airplay but a new version is coming out later this to be compatible with miracast applications.
Bluetooth connection is strong and sound is pretty clear but not as strong as say a sony or jvc unit, amp will fix this.

If dealing with Eonon head office to return a unit, postage is $60 through fedex and Eonon pay $40 of that.

The M1 is easy to navigate but the miracast / DLNA setup is a bit to work out. You can surf the net via 3g (dongle or phone) as well

Hodge
7th August 2013, 12:19 PM
Well 6 days in the car now and the screen, seems dead, kind of.
Everything worked flawlessly, I was very impressed with it and OziExplorer with my hema maps worked perfectly which I was rapped about! Seems too good for the price but now, seems like it's come to bite me... Unit turns on, screen comes out displays the nissan logo (so the screen works?) and then goes blank. However there is still sound, and when I touch the screen it seems to respond to my touch commands but just will not display anything. Tried the generic remedies from Eonons website like reset the unit, unpower it completely etc... Didn't work. Contacted them directly and through eBay, sent a video to them showing exactly what's going on. 48 hours now and no response.

As for your earlier comment about slide out screens. 2 reasons I went for such unit;
1. I really don't like how a double din unit sits so low on GU's you gotta sort of look way down to see anything especially if a screen is so interactive like these new age units. So this unit i got has the screen that goes up and brings it sort of to just below eye level for easier viewing especially for navigation.
2. I got this unit as a single din, so that I can make use of the lower single din space for the UHF unit.

But pending how this turns out with this unit, I might be going back to a single din unit. Either way not happy atm.
